My husband and I visited for the first time today having recently moved from Leeds to Halifax. We were hoping to find a new favourite Sunday roast spot, and we certainly have! We both opted for the roast pork belly and agreed it was one of the best roast dinners we've ever had at a restaurant: perfectly cooked pork belly, generous portion size and delicious sides- we both loved the cauliflower cheese. Service was attentive without being too much, and the restaurant's setting in the historic Dean Clough was the cherry on top! We're already planning our next visit, thank you True North :)

Paulicarus fancied a proper Sunday roast dinner so booked a table here. Friends had been before. Sat in what apparently had once been Europe's largest carpet factory. Certainly a huge building. A starter and main for £25. Two lamb and two beef. Good veg selection. We had starters of one wings, one paté and two chose asparagus and sea bass. All excellent. Good service and good wine. No real ale so Paulicarus had a £6.00 pint of lager. Very attentive service.
